About this map

The Igichuk Hills dominate the southern portion of this landscape within the Cape Krusenstern National Monument, where the terrain rises sharply from the surrounding coastal plains. The area is defined by the winding course of Kilikmak Cr, which flows through the eastern and central sections of the quadrangle. This 2015 survey by the U.S. Geological Survey reflects a largely unpopulated expanse of the Northwest Arctic Borough, where the intricate network of drainage and elevation contours illustrates a subarctic environment preserved for its archaeological and ecological significance. The lack of infrastructure highlights the wild character of these hills, which serve as a critical landmark for navigation and seasonal movement across the tundra.
